Felipe
Gonzalez
Felipe Gonzalez is a 500-hour ERYT and Katonah Yoga® teacher based in New York City. Felipe came to the practice in 2006 when he first moved to New York City. In 2014, he took the leap of faith and completed his 200 hour teacher training at Laughing Lotus, NYC.

His devotion to music, movement, story telling, and spirituality are embedded in all of his classes. Using the techniques of mythology, mantra, yogic philosophy, asana, and Katonah Yoga® theory, he guides practitioners through an experience of breath, vibration, movement, and reflection.
Felipe is a founding yoga teacher at The Joyful Liberation Collective, a community lead organization uplifting marginalized voices, and he is a Legacy Ambassador for Lululemon. Felipe leads workshops, retreats, and trainings internationally. Drawn to the disciplines of Vinyasa, Bhakti Yoga, and Katonah Yoga theory, he devotes his practice and teaching with an artist’s soul and a healer’s heart.
